There are a wide variety of document management systems available on the market today. They perform the tasks of managing stored files and index data, as well as giving users an interface to search for and view these images. Many perform advanced functions like workflow management, revision tracking, and access auditing for HIPAA and other regulations.

Integration with third party document management software is done via the Index Log files that SimpleIndex creates. Documents are scanned and indexed with SimpleIndex, and a log file is created that lists each image scanned and the index information associated with it.

Direct integration of document and index data via HTTP Post is also available.

Most document management software comes with standard or optional components that allow you to automatically import images and index information in the format SimpleIndex provides.

Systems that require custom XML or proprietary import file formats can be integrated with as well. Index files can be converted to any format with an XSLT formatting file. The SimpleExport application adds custom variables, Base64 image conversion and other advanced features.
